Most of the world's spiritual classics are already in the public domain, yet they sit scattered across difficult scans, cluttered websites, and editions that fight the reader. The Wisdom Library gathers them into one calm reading room.

Six traditions are represented so far. Taoism through the Tao Te Ching. Buddhism through the Dhammapada. Advaita Vedanta through the Ashtavakra Gita, the Vivekachudamani, and Max Müller's lectures. Sufism through Rumi's Divan and his Masnavi. Christian and Jewish mysticism through their own classics, including the Kabbalah Unveiled. Each is a faithful translation presented with its structure intact, verse as verse and chapters as chapters.

Begin with a single text that calls to you, or move between several, and a pattern begins to show. Beneath the different languages, images and names, the same recognition keeps returning. It is what is sometimes called the perennial philosophy, the one truth found at the root of all the world's great traditions. The Wisdom Library is gathered around that thread. However many doors these texts seem to open, they open onto the same room, and the whole of it points, in the end, to Unity.
